
Chicken Fajita Tacos
servings: 2 | prepping time: 15 min | cooking time: 30 min |
Ingredients
2 kg boneless meat (chicken, fish, or red meat)
3 Tbsps Oil
2 Tsps Fajita Seasoning
2 Tbsps Lemon juice
Salt TT
1/2 Tsp red chili powder (if spicy is preferred)
Julienned Bell pepper, red pepper and onion
To serve
Flour tortilla
Salsa
Sour Cream
Lemon/lime wedges
Directions
- Begin by marinating the meat with oil, Fajita seasoning, lemon juice, and salt. Cover and let the flavors merry for 30 minutes to 1 hour.
- In a hot pan, fry the meat on medium to low heat until tender. Once cooked, remove the pan from the heat, and in the same pan juices sautee the vegetables. Season them with salt and pepper.
- Now assemble the tacos. Lightly toast the tortilla in a hot dry pan until warm. Place the vegetables, chicken, salsa, and sour cream on the tortilla. Garnish with fresh coriander, lemon juice and a generous sprinkling of the Fajita seasoning.
